From 6a2e7592829ce9fa45f6b01be3e96737a1e45a6d Mon Sep 17 00:00:00 2001 From: meichthys <10717998+meichthys@users.noreply.github.com> Date: Wed, 29 Jun 2022 00:53:24 -0400 Subject: [PATCH] Add Photo map, discovery, album, timeline, video features --- readme.md | 45 ++++++++++++++++++++++++++------------------- 1 file changed, 26 insertions(+), 19 deletions(-) diff --git a/readme.md b/readme.md index b9d005a..511c280 100644 --- a/readme.md +++ b/readme.md @@ -11,25 +11,32 @@ I've been on a quest to replace most of my daily software needs with open-source **Tip:** Hover over icons for missing/incomplete features for more information -| Feature | [Damselfly](https://github.com/Webreaper/Damselfly) | [Immich](https://github.com/alextran1502/immich) | [Librephotos](https://github.com/LibrePhotos/librephotos) | [Nextcloud Photos](https://github.com/nextcloud/photos/) | [Photonix](https://github.com/photonixapp/photonix) | [PiGallery2](https://github.com/bpatrik/pigallery2) | [Photoprism](https://github.com/photoprism/photoprism) | [Photoview](https://github.com/photoview/photoview) | [Piwigo](https://github.com/Piwigo/Piwigo) | -| :------------------------ | -------------------------------------------------------- | :------------------------------------------------------------------------ | -------------------------------------------------------------- | ----------------------------------------------------------- | ----------------------------------------------------------- | ----------------------------------------------------- | :----------------------------------------------------------------------------------------------- | ------------------------------------------------------------------------------- | ------------------------------------------------------- | -| Github Stars (6/2022) | 682 | 1.8k | 4.2k | 274 | 1.3k | 869 | 21.1k | 2.7k | 1.9k | -| Active Contributors | 1 | 1 | 1 | 2 | 1 | 1 | 4 | 1 | 3 | -| Source Language | C# | Dart | Python | JavaScript | Python | TypeScript | Go | Typescript/Go | PHP | -| License | GPL 3.0 | MIT | MIT | AGPL 3.0 | AGPL 3.0 | MIT | GPL 3.0 | AGPL 3.0 | GPL 2.0 | -| Freeness | ✅🔟 | ✅🔟 | ✅🔟 | ✅🔟 | ✅🔟 | ✅🔟 | [🚧](https://photoprism.app/get)7️⃣ | ✅🔟 | ✅🔟 | -| Automatic Mobile Upload | [❌](https://github.com/Webreaper/Damselfly/issues/40) | ✅7️⃣ | ❌ | ✅4️⃣ | ❌ | ❌ | ✅6️⃣ | [❌](https://github.com/photoview/photoview/issues/129) | ✅7️⃣ | -| Web App | ✅8️⃣ | ✅8️⃣ | ✅8️⃣ | ✅5️⃣ | ✅7️⃣ | ✅7️⃣ | ✅7️⃣ | ✅8️⃣ | ✅8️⃣ | -| Mobile App | ❌ | [✅](https://github.com/alextran1502/immich#step-4-run-mobile-app)6️⃣ | [✅](https://github.com/LibrePhotos/librephotos-mobile)6️⃣ | [✅](https://nextcloud.com/clients/)5️⃣ | [✅](https://github.com/photonixapp/photonix-mobile)4️⃣ | ❌ | [🚧](https://docs.photoprism.app/user-guide/pwa/https://github.com/nextcloud/photos/issues/14) | [✅](https://apps.apple.com/dk/app/photoview-media-gallery/id1578380271)6️⃣ | [✅](https://www.piwigo.org/mobile-applications)7️⃣ | -| Desktop App | ✅9️⃣ | ❌ | ❌ | ❌ | [❌](https://github.com/photonixapp/photonix/issues/61) | ❌ | ❌ | ❌ | ❌ | -| LivePhotos Support | ❌ | [❌](https://github.com/alextran1502/immich/issues/160) | [❌](https://github.com/LibrePhotos/librephotos/issues/287) | ✅7️⃣ | [❌](https://github.com/photonixapp/photonix/issues/250) | ❌ | ✅5️⃣ | [❌](https://github.com/photoview/photoview/issues/273) | [❌](https://github.com/Piwigo/Piwigo/issues/1677) | -| Photo Sharing | ❌ | ✅4️⃣ | ✅9️⃣ | ✅5️⃣ | ❌ | ✅7️⃣ | ✅7️⃣ | ✅8️⃣ | ✅5️⃣ | -| Photo Search | ✅8️⃣ | ✅7️⃣ | ✅8️⃣ | ✅3️⃣ | ✅8️⃣ | ✅7️⃣ | ✅8️⃣ | ✅5️⃣ | ✅7️⃣ | -| Docker Installation | ✅8️⃣ | ✅7️⃣ | ✅7️⃣ | ✅6️⃣ | ✅8️⃣ | ✅7️⃣ | ✅6️⃣ | ✅8️⃣ | [❌](https://github.com/Piwigo/Piwigo/pull/816) | -| Object/Face Recognition | ✅8️⃣ | ✅6️⃣ | ✅8️⃣ | [🚧](https://github.com/nextcloud/photos/issues/144)3️⃣ | ✅8️⃣ | ✅6️⃣ | ✅9️⃣ | ✅6️⃣ | [🚧](https://github.com/Piwigo/Piwigo/issues/1159) | -| Basic Editing | ❌ | ❌ | ❌ | ❌ | ❌ | ❌ | ❌ | ❌ | ❌ | -| EXIF data viewing | ✅9️⃣ | ✅7️⃣ | ❌ | [❌](https://github.com/nextcloud/photos/issues/226) | ✅7️⃣ | ✅7️⃣ | ✅9️⃣ | ✅7️⃣ | ✅7️⃣ | -| Multiple User Support | ✅7️⃣ | ✅7️⃣ | ✅8️⃣ | ✅7️⃣ | ✅6️⃣ | ✅7️⃣ | [❌](https://github.com/photoprism/photoprism/issues/98) | ✅6️⃣ | ✅8️⃣ | + +| Feature | [Damselfly](https://github.com/Webreaper/Damselfly) | [Immich](https://github.com/alextran1502/immich) | [Librephotos](https://github.com/LibrePhotos/librephotos) | [Nextcloud Photos](https://github.com/nextcloud/photos/) | [Photonix](https://github.com/photonixapp/photonix) | [PiGallery2](https://github.com/bpatrik/pigallery2) | [Photoprism](https://github.com/photoprism/photoprism) | [Photoview](https://github.com/photoview/photoview) | [Piwigo](https://github.com/Piwigo/Piwigo) | +| :------------------------ | --------------------------------------------------------- | :------------------------------------------------------------------------ | -------------------------------------------------------------- | ----------------------------------------------------------- | ----------------------------------------------------------- | ----------------------------------------------------- | :----------------------------------------------------------------------------------------------- | ------------------------------------------------------------------------------- | ------------------------------------------------------- | +| Github Stars (6/2022) | 682 | 1.8k | 4.2k | 274 | 1.3k | 869 | 21.1k | 2.7k | 1.9k | +| Active Contributors | 1 | 1 | 1 | 2 | 1 | 1 | 4 | 1 | 3 | +| Source Language | C# | Dart | Python | JavaScript | Python | TypeScript | Go | Typescript/Go | PHP | +| License | GPL 3.0 | MIT | MIT | AGPL 3.0 | AGPL 3.0 | MIT | GPL 3.0 | AGPL 3.0 | GPL 2.0 | +| Demo | ❌ | ❌ | ✅6️⃣ | [✅](https://)7️⃣ | [✅](https://demo.photonix.org/login)8️⃣ | [✅](https://pigallery2.herokuapp.com/gallery)8️⃣ | [✅](https://try.photoprism.app)9️⃣ | [✅](https://photos.qpqp.dk/)9️⃣ | [✅](https://piwigo.org/demo)9️⃣ | +| Freeness | ✅🔟 | ✅🔟 | ✅🔟 | ✅🔟 | ✅🔟 | ✅🔟 | [🚧](https://photoprism.app/get)7️⃣ | ✅🔟 | ✅🔟 | +| Automatic Mobile Upload | [❌](https://github.com/Webreaper/Damselfly/issues/40) | ✅7️⃣ | ❌ | ✅4️⃣ | ❌ | ❌ | ✅6️⃣ | [❌](https://github.com/photoview/photoview/issues/129) | ✅7️⃣ | +| Web App | ✅8️⃣ | ✅8️⃣ | ✅8️⃣ | ✅5️⃣ | ✅7️⃣ | ✅7️⃣ | ✅7️⃣ | ✅8️⃣ | ✅8️⃣ | +| Mobile App | ❌ | [✅](https://github.com/alextran1502/immich#step-4-run-mobile-app)6️⃣ | [✅](https://github.com/LibrePhotos/librephotos-mobile)6️⃣ | [✅](https://nextcloud.com/clients/)5️⃣ | [✅](https://github.com/photonixapp/photonix-mobile)4️⃣ | ❌ | [🚧](https://docs.photoprism.app/user-guide/pwa/https://github.com/nextcloud/photos/issues/14) | [✅](https://apps.apple.com/dk/app/photoview-media-gallery/id1578380271)6️⃣ | [✅](https://www.piwigo.org/mobile-applications)7️⃣ | +| Desktop App | ✅9️⃣ | ❌ | ❌ | ❌ | [❌](https://github.com/photonixapp/photonix/issues/61) | ❌ | ❌ | ❌ | ❌ | +| LivePhotos Support | ❌ | [❌](https://github.com/alextran1502/immich/issues/160) | [❌](https://github.com/LibrePhotos/librephotos/issues/287) | ✅7️⃣ | [❌](https://github.com/photonixapp/photonix/issues/250) | ❌ | ✅7️⃣ | [❌](https://github.com/photoview/photoview/issues/273) | [❌](https://github.com/Piwigo/Piwigo/issues/1677) | +| Video Support | [❌](https://github.com/Webreaper/Damselfly/issues/82) | ✅8️⃣ | ✅8️⃣ | ✅6️⃣ | [❌](https://github.com/photonixapp/photonix/issues/295) | ✅8️⃣ | ✅7️⃣ | ✅7️⃣ | ✅4️⃣ | +| Photo Map | [❌](https://github.com/Webreaper/Damselfly/issues/312) | ✅4️⃣ | ✅8️⃣ | ✅6️⃣ | ✅9️⃣ | ✅8️⃣ | ✅7️⃣ | ✅8️⃣ | ❌ | +| Photo Discovery | ❌ | ❌ | ✅7️⃣ | ✅3️⃣ | ❌ | ❌ | ✅6️⃣ | ❌ | ✅1️⃣ | +| Albums | [❌](https://github.com/Webreaper/Damselfly/issues/238) | ✅8️⃣ | ✅9️⃣ | ✅3️⃣ | ✅5️⃣ | ✅6️⃣ | ✅8️⃣ | ✅6️⃣ | ✅8️⃣ | +| Timeline | ✅5️⃣ | ✅9️⃣ | ✅9️⃣ | ✅5️⃣ | ✅5️⃣ | ✅5️⃣ | ✅5️⃣ | ✅9️⃣ | ✅3️⃣ | +| Photo Sharing | ❌ | ✅4️⃣ | ✅9️⃣ | ✅5️⃣ | ❌ | ✅7️⃣ | ✅7️⃣ | ✅8️⃣ | ✅5️⃣ | +| Photo Search | ✅8️⃣ | ✅7️⃣ | ✅8️⃣ | ✅3️⃣ | ✅8️⃣ | ✅7️⃣ | ✅8️⃣ | ✅5️⃣ | ✅7️⃣ | +| Docker Installation | ✅8️⃣ | ✅7️⃣ | ✅7️⃣ | ✅6️⃣ | ✅8️⃣ | ✅7️⃣ | ✅6️⃣ | ✅8️⃣ | [❌](https://github.com/Piwigo/Piwigo/pull/816) | +| Object/Face Recognition | ✅8️⃣ | ✅6️⃣ | ✅8️⃣ | [🚧](https://github.com/nextcloud/photos/issues/144)3️⃣ | ✅8️⃣ | ✅6️⃣ | ✅9️⃣ | ✅6️⃣ | [🚧](https://github.com/Piwigo/Piwigo/issues/1159) | +| Basic Editing | ❌ | ❌ | ❌ | ❌ | ❌ | ❌ | ❌ | ❌ | ❌ | +| EXIF data viewing | ✅9️⃣ | ✅7️⃣ | [❌](https://github.com/LibrePhotos/librephotos/issues/77) | [❌](https://github.com/nextcloud/photos/issues/226) | ✅7️⃣ | ✅7️⃣ | ✅9️⃣ | ✅7️⃣ | ✅7️⃣ | +| Multiple User Support | ✅7️⃣ | ✅7️⃣ | ✅8️⃣ | ✅7️⃣ | ✅7️⃣ | ✅7️⃣ | [❌](https://github.com/photoprism/photoprism/issues/98) | ✅6️⃣ | ✅8️⃣ | **Note:** This list is by no means comprehensive. For links to other photo library projects, see the [Awesome Self-Hosted](https://github.com/awesome-selfhosted/awesome-selfhosted#photo-and-video-galleries) list.